MRI Trigeminal

Overview

MRI Trigeminal is a specialized magnetic resonance imaging examination used to evaluate the trigeminal nerve, one of the major cranial nerves responsible for facial sensation and certain motor functions. This advanced imaging technique provides highly detailed images of the trigeminal nerve pathway, brainstem, surrounding blood vessels, cranial structures, and adjacent soft tissues.

The examination is commonly recommended for patients experiencing facial pain, trigeminal neuralgia, facial numbness, tingling sensations, nerve dysfunction, suspected nerve compression, tumors, or unexplained neurological symptoms affecting the face. MRI provides superior visualization of cranial nerves and helps physicians accurately diagnose disorders involving the trigeminal nerve.

Preparation Before the Test

  • No special preparation is generally required.
  • Inform your doctor about pacemakers, implants, or metallic devices.
  • Remove jewelry and metallic accessories before the scan.
  • Carry previous neurological imaging reports if available.
  • Inform the radiology team if you are pregnant or claustrophobic.
  • Follow any additional instructions if contrast imaging is planned.

Detailed Information

MRI Trigeminal is an advanced diagnostic imaging examination specifically designed to assess the trigeminal nerve and related neurological structures. The trigeminal nerve is the fifth cranial nerve and is responsible for transmitting sensory information from the face to the brain while also controlling certain muscles involved in chewing.

The examination is particularly useful for diagnosing trigeminal neuralgia, vascular compression syndromes, nerve inflammation, demyelinating disorders such as multiple sclerosis, tumors, and congenital abnormalities. MRI provides exceptional soft tissue contrast and detailed visualization of nerve pathways.

The scan can identify neurovascular compression, trigeminal nerve lesions, schwannomas, meningiomas, inflammatory changes, demyelinating plaques, brainstem abnormalities, and other causes of facial pain and sensory disturbances. Early diagnosis helps physicians develop appropriate medical, interventional, or surgical treatment strategies.

MRI Trigeminal is frequently requested by neurologists, neurosurgeons, pain management specialists, ENT specialists, and maxillofacial surgeons. The examination assists in diagnosis, treatment planning, surgical evaluation, and long-term monitoring of trigeminal nerve disorders.

The procedure is painless and non-invasive. During the examination, the patient lies comfortably inside the MRI scanner while high-resolution images of the trigeminal nerve and surrounding structures are obtained. The scan typically takes between 20 and 45 minutes. Reports are generally available within 2 to 3 hours after interpretation by an experienced radiologist.

Test FAQs

What is MRI Trigeminal?

MRI Trigeminal is a specialized MRI examination used to evaluate the trigeminal nerve and related cranial nerve structures.

Why is this test performed?

The test helps diagnose trigeminal neuralgia, facial pain, nerve compression, tumors, and neurological disorders.

Can MRI detect trigeminal neuralgia?

Yes. MRI can identify vascular compression and structural abnormalities associated with trigeminal neuralgia.

Can MRI identify nerve compression?

Yes. MRI provides detailed visualization of blood vessels and structures that may compress the trigeminal nerve.

Can MRI detect tumors affecting the trigeminal nerve?

Yes. MRI can identify tumors such as schwannomas, meningiomas, and other lesions affecting the nerve pathway.

Is MRI Trigeminal painful?

No. The examination is completely non-invasive and painless.

How long does the scan take?

Most MRI Trigeminal examinations take approximately 20 to 45 minutes.

Can MRI diagnose multiple sclerosis-related nerve involvement?

Yes. MRI can detect demyelinating changes affecting the trigeminal nerve and brainstem.
